I tend to not hear about expeditions until it's too late... does anyone know of a way to get email or push notifications for upcoming expeditions?

They don't advertise it at all, but the official website has an atom feed at https://www.nomanssky.com/feed/ which you can subscribe to from an rss reader/news reader. Recent entries include expedition announcements and bugfixes.

Look out for updates, generally a new expedition starts some days after one is released, on the official website.

Steam offer a way to keep track of updates (even experimental and internal builds)

Keep an eye on Seam Murray Twitter account, it seems to be a tradition that once he post an emoji then a new update is somewhat imminent.
